The statement regarding the operation of electronic and magnetic transformers being controlled by the same dimmers is indeed false. This is primarily due to the differences in how these two types of transformers operate and the technologies they use.

Electronic transformers typically employ a high-frequency switching method to transform power, while magnetic transformers work using electromagnetic induction at the line frequency (50/60 Hz). This fundamental difference in operation leads to different requirements for dimming capabilities. Many dimmers designed for magnetic transformers may not be compatible with electronic transformers, which can result in flickering, buzzing, or even damage to the transformer or the dimmer. Therefore, using the same dimmers for both types is not feasible across the board.

The other statements highlight characteristics that are part of the established knowledge of electrical transformers. Electronic transformers are indeed quieter than their magnetic counterparts because their operation can produce less audible noise, often due to the absence of physical components like coils and cores that vibrate. Additionally, electronic transformers generally run cooler than magnetic ones because they are more efficient, converting a higher percentage of electrical energy into usable power without excessive heat production.
